mito helps you understand what happens inside the body during fasting.
Instead of simply counting hours, mito visualizes the metabolic stages of fasting. Animated stages illustrate how the body gradually shifts from digestion and blood sugar regulation to stored glucose use and increasing reliance on fat metabolism.
Most fasting apps simply count hours. mito explains how your metabolism gradually changes during a fast and what these changes mean for your body.
Each stage includes a short article that explains what is happening in the body, making the biology of fasting easier to understand — not just something you track.
